This summary comes from the ClinGen Evidence Repository: NM_001369369.1(FOXN1):c.930A>G (p.Thr310=) is a synonymous variant. SpliceAI predicts no impact to the splice consensus sequence (delta score 0.00) nor the creation of a new splice site (delta score<=0.01) and the nucleotide is not highly conserved (phyloP score -1.54) (BP4, BP7). The gnomADv2.1.1 PopMax filtering AF is 0.002017 based on 66/24964alleles in the African/African American population, which is above the >0.00141 threshold for BS1. In summary this variant meets criteria to be classified as likely benign for semidominant T-cell immunodeficiency, congenital alopecia, and nail dystrophy due to FOXN1 deficiency based on the ACMG/AMP criteria applied: BS1, BP4, and BP7 as specified by the ClinGen SCID VCEP FOXN1 subgroup. FOXN1 (HGNC:12765): (forkhead box N1) Mutations in the winged-helix transcription factor gene at the nude locus in mice and rats produce the pleiotropic phenotype of hairlessness and athymia, resulting in a severely compromised immune system. This gene is orthologous to the mouse and rat genes and encodes a similar DNA-binding transcription factor that is thought to regulate keratin gene expression. A mutation in this gene has been correlated with T-cell immunodeficiency, the skin disorder congenital alopecia, and nail dystrophy. Alternative splicing in the 5' UTR of this gene has been observed.
